  • Title

    A network locality aware algorithm based on identity mapping

  • Abstract
    Separation of identifier and locator provides good conditions of routing scalability and mobility for Internet routing and IP addressing. Based on the idea of identifier and locator separation, in this paper we introduce the access identifier (AID) and the routing locator (RLOC), design a network locality-aware distributed hash table (NLA-DHT), then present an identifier mapping information storage algorithm with network locality-aware capability (N3-Chord). Simulation performance shows that, the identifiers of distributed network storage nodes assigned by NLA-DHT with good query performance in network topology locality consistency, and the query efficiency and network fault handling capability of N3-Chord is much superior to ChordFingerPNS and ChordFinger.
